Not only that, if you only go up the tree to management 3, you will only have pet levels +19, which means you could call 2 pets who's CL adds up to 19. One could be 10 and the other 9. Even adding Management 4 (cheapest skill point cost at that point) would only add 5 more, so you could have 2 CL 12 pets.

I think if you wanted to have gurrecks out, you would have to invest at least 1 more tree to do so, although I'm not positive.

Locrum, BE creature types are simply shells. The BE combines the DNA and gets a template. It can be CL 10 or it can be CL 70.

They take this template then can put it into any of their available creature skins. It can be a durni or a kimogilla, but its CL is based on the template, not the creature as it used to be.

There are still some advantages to certain skins such as speed, size and whether considered vicious or wild, but mainly it is an aestetic choice.
